Brake fluid exchange is a crucial part of maintaining your vehicle’s safety and performance. Over time, brake fluid absorbs moisture and contaminants, which can compromise your braking system and reduce stopping power. When your brake fluid is no longer at its best, you may notice a spongy pedal, longer stopping distances, or even a warning light on your dashboard. Brake fluid is the lifeblood of your braking system. It transfers the force from your foot on the pedal to the brake pads and rotors that stop your car. As brake fluid ages, it absorbs moisture from the air, which can lower its boiling point and increase the risk of brake fading, especially during hard stops or in hot conditions. Neglected brake fluid can lead to corrosion inside the brake lines, calipers, and master cylinder. Moisture and contaminants accelerate wear on these critical components, potentially causing leaks, sticking calipers, or even brake failure. Every brake fluid exchange at Grease Monkey starts with a thorough inspection. Our team checks the fluid level, color, and clarity. We use specialized test strips or electronic testers to measure the moisture content and boiling point of your brake fluid. If results show contamination or a drop in performance, our team will recommend a brake fluid flush and replacement based on manufacturer requirements.
Once a brake fluid exchange is needed, our team follows a precise process to ensure your braking system is restored to peak condition. The old fluid is safely removed from the master cylinder, brake lines, and calipers or wheel cylinders. We then flush the system with new fluid that meets or exceeds your vehicle’s manufacturer specifications. This process removes trapped air, moisture, and contaminants. Finally, we refill the system with fresh brake fluid, bleed the brakes to remove any air bubbles, and test the pedal feel and system pressure.

Brake fluid is hygroscopic, meaning it naturally absorbs water from the air over time. Even in a sealed system, moisture can enter through hoses and seals. This gradual contamination lowers the fluid’s boiling point and can lead to vapor lock, spongy brakes, or corrosion. Regular brake fluid flush and replacement help prevent these issues and keeps your brakes working as designed.
Many drivers wonder when to change brake fluid or how often to replace brake fluid. While recommendations can vary, most manufacturers suggest a brake fluid exchange every 2 to 3 years. Always refer to your vehicle owner’s manual for the exact interval. You may see both terms used, but brake fluid exchange and brake fluid flush often refer to the same essential process: removing used fluid and replacing it with fresh fluid. Some providers use “flush” to describe a more thorough service, while “exchange” may refer to replacing the fluid through standard service procedures. Extending the recommended interval between brake fluid exchanges can lead to increased moisture and contamination in your brake system. This raises the risk of brake fade, corrosion, and even component failure.
